Talking to reporters here, he said the four-lane road work, named as 'Bharat Matha' project, would, along with the decision to deepen the Colachel port in Kanyakumari district, would lead to "economic boom of south Tamil Nadu."
"Colachel port would become gateway to South India, as an International shipping destination, " he said and this "will make South India more prosperous."
Apart from the SSCP, a Rs 34,000-crore project for building a bridge that would link Talaimannar with Danushkodi would be undertaken. A feasibility study was now going on for the project, he added.
On delay in the implementation of the road projects, he said, some formalities like acquisition of lands needed state government support. But the Central government was getting all the cooperation, and work on road project linking Kanyakumari to Kerala had started after a long gap.
Toll gate collection was also being streamlined under the "E-Toll" scheme,and there would not be any complaint about excess toll collection, he added.
